1
0
Fork 0
mirror of https://github.com/Luzifer/continuous-spark.git synced 2024-10-18 04:44:24 +00:00
Daemon intended to do continuous tests against a sparkyfish server
Find a file
Knut Ahlers 54a704f19d
Fix linter warnings
Signed-off-by: Knut Ahlers <knut@ahlers.me>
2017-07-28 07:29:16 +02:00
Godeps Vendor dependencies 2017-07-28 07:24:58 +02:00
vendor Vendor dependencies 2017-07-28 07:24:58 +02:00
.gitignore Keep a local log of all measures 2017-07-28 07:13:51 +02:00
.repo-runner.yaml Add automated building 2017-07-28 07:23:09 +02:00
LICENSE Add license 2017-07-26 11:29:30 +02:00
main.go Keep a local log of all measures 2017-07-28 07:13:51 +02:00
Makefile Add automated building 2017-07-28 07:23:09 +02:00
ping.go Initial version 2017-07-26 11:29:10 +02:00
README.md Add README 2017-07-28 07:22:15 +02:00
screenshot.png Add README 2017-07-28 07:22:15 +02:00
spark.go Fix linter warnings 2017-07-28 07:29:16 +02:00
throughput.go Initial version 2017-07-26 11:29:10 +02:00

Go Report Card

Luzifer / continuous-spark

This tool is a daemon intended to do continuous tests against a sparkyfish server. The measurements are sent to StatHat for graphing and are stored locally in a TSV file for reference.

Why? Quite easy: My internet connection is quite often way slower (170Kbit vs. 200Mbit) as promised in the contract I'm paying for so I set up this daemon on my NAS connected using 2x1Gbit cable to my providers FritzBox. On the other side an unmodified sparkyfish server is running on a 1Gbit datacenter connection. The test is executed every 15m and looking at the graph causes me to weep...